Subject: Bucketly cut-over complete

Team — the A/B assignment service cut over to Bucketly v2 last night. Old hash-ring assignments frozen; new traffic uses the deterministic seeded bucketer. No assignment flips observed in the shadow run, and p99 latency dropped from 14ms to 6ms. Legacy endpoint stays read-only for two weeks, then dies. Dashboards updated. For the sync, here's the production configuration Bucketly is now running with.

settings of bawif-fawif:
ralix:
  log_level: warn
  metrics_host: metrics.ralix.tolvaqsys.internal
  pool_size: 32

## KeyMill 2.7 — changed defaults

Heads up, plugin folks: KeyMill's rotation utility now defaults to staggered rotation instead of big-bang. If your plugin assumed all secrets flip at once, you'll see a short overlap window where old and new credentials are both valid — that's intentional, not a bug. Grace windows shrank too, so cache credentials for less time. Everything is overridable, but we'd rather you adapt than opt out. The shipped defaults now look like this:

service settings:
PRAIX_LOG_LEVEL=error
PRAIX_METRICS_HOST=metrics.praix.qorvelcorp.corp
PRAIX_POOL_SIZE=16

Ticket WPO-412: The pick-list optimizer at the Dunmore fulfillment site is reading prod slotting data in the staging environment, causing bogus route suggestions. For future maintainers: the culprit is a stale `.env` copied during the June migration. Set `OPTIMIZER_ENV=staging` and `SLOT_DB_HOST` to the staging replica. After those edits, add the staging database credential on the line directly below.

env line for fafof-fahag: LEDGER_TOKEN5=f8790